    Itinerary

    Day 1

    Arrival in Paro

    Arrive in Paro and settle into the valley’s calm atmosphere. Visit Rinpung Dzong and take an evening walk along the river — a gentle introduction to Bhutan travel.

    Day 2

    Paro to Thimphu

    Drive to Thimphu, Bhutan’s capital. Visit Buddha Dordenma and Tashichho Dzong, followed by time in local markets. Overnight in Thimphu.

    Day 3

    Thimphu Sightseeing

    Explore the Folk Heritage Museum, National Textile Museum, and a monastery school. This day highlights cultural tours and monasteries in Bhutan beyond the postcard sights.

    Day 4

    Thimphu to Punakha

    Cross Dochula Pass (3,100m), one of Bhutan’s most scenic viewpoints. Visit Punakha Dzong, set between two rivers, and enjoy the warmer valley climate.

    Day 5

    Punakha to Bumthang

    Travel east through changing landscapes into Bumthang, the spiritual heart of Bhutan. The journey itself feels like a pilgrimage, passing forests, rivers, and quiet villages.

    Day 6

    Bumthang Sacred Sites

    Visit Jambay Lhakhang, Kurjey Lhakhang, and Tamshing Monastery — temples deeply tied to Guru Rinpoche. These moments often become the emotional center of the trip.

    Day 7

    Bumthang Valley Exploration

    Explore rural Bumthang on foot, visit local farms, and enjoy time for reflection. Optional light walks make this suitable even for Bhutan trekking tours for beginners.

    Day 8

    Bumthang to Punakha

    Return west, retracing scenic mountain roads. The long drive is broken with stops at villages and viewpoints.

    Day 9

    Punakha to Paro

    Drive back to Paro. Hike to Taktsang (Tiger’s Nest), Bhutan’s most iconic monastery. The climb is steady and rewarding, offering both physical and spiritual perspective In the evening, visit Kyichu Lhakhang, one of Bhutan’s oldest temples — a quiet, powerful place before the journey ends.
